Terminal interception has touchpoints but no connection; user interception means touch equals connection. -01- In deep distribution to terminals, sales representatives and shopping guides have an important job: terminal interception. Terminal interception is carried out in three aspects: First, terminal product display, including end caps and displays. Because displays and end caps are user touchpoints. Without touchpoints, users cannot perceive the product. This is something all stores, including KA and small shops, must do. Some companies even have a dedicated role: merchandisers, who check dozens of stores a day. Second, shopping guide assistance. Initially called promoters, now called shopping guides. Shopping guides are also user touchpoints. Generally, only KA stores can afford shopping guides. Third, promotional policies, often implemented together with end caps and shopping guides, using policies to attract users. I once made an analogy: the biggest sellers in KA are not the strongest brands or the lowest-priced products, but the most active products at the terminal. The standard for active terminal products is "promotions every day, changing every week." A fatal flaw of terminal interception in the deep distribution era is that interception is one-time. There is interception but no connection. Next time, users might be intercepted by another brand. -02- When B2C and O2O rose, the "ground promotion" role emerged. Alibaba, Meituan, and others did it. Pinduoduo's user growth was different, using user fission. Ground promotion is also user interception, and it also starts from terminal interception. For internet platforms, ground promotion means connection. Once connected, users move from offline to online, becoming platform users. Ground promotion terminal interception is very costly. If density is not achieved, the platform fails. It's either 0 or 1. However, ground promotion is also one-time. Once the platform takes off, ground promotion is no longer needed. After ground promotion intercepts users to the platform, users belong to the platform, unrelated to offline. Therefore, cooperating with internet platforms is quite unfortunate. Platforms are black holes; every ground promotion brings traffic into the platform. -03- New retail is also intercepting users. In digitalization, intercepting users means getting users online. Intercepting users requires touchpoints to reach them. New retail intercepts users through: digital payment, online ordering, digital scenarios, and personnel interception. New retail stores typically have digital payment channels. As long as digital payment is used, users are reached online. Online ordering in the restaurant industry is a hard interception method. Leading restaurant companies are basically all online ordering, some even only online ordering. Scenario interception involves setting up special scenarios in stores and intercepting through QR code scans. Personnel interception uses store owners, staff, and shopping guides as interception touchpoints. -04- Digitalization of traditional channels includes two major modules: one is full-link connection; the other is full-scenario reach. Full-scenario reach is user interception and user touch, aiming to achieve user online presence. Once a user is touched, they can be retained through online stickiness. Digital user touch roughly has three major scenarios: product, person, and store. Using product as a touchpoint, such as one product one code. Each scan is an entry point for users to go online. Using person as a touchpoint has two modes: one is terminal personnel, including store owners, staff, and shopping guides; the other is KOC reach, as in the "scenario experience + KOC + cloud store" model we proposed in three-dimensional connection, which is a user reach model. Using store as a touchpoint includes the store itself and store scenarios (such as coolers, shelves, displays, etc.). Person, product, and store are collectively called the three super touchpoints. User touchpoints are the main interface for intercepting users. Therefore, the term touchpoint has become the key to full-scenario reach. -05- In the deep distribution era, the work of sales representatives included channel work and terminal work, with the main work at the terminal. In the digital era, distributors transform into operators. Operators have three main tasks: B-end relationship, C-end user reach, and BC integrated operation. In the digital era, channel relationship (B-end) still exists. But because of BC integration, channels have pull, reducing B-end workload. Reaching C-end users becomes the main task. Without reaching C-end, digitalization is useless. The main work is on the user side (C-end). Deep distribution has reached millions of terminals; the next step is only through tens of millions of touchpoints to reach hundreds of millions of users. Only by reaching users can the next important task be carried out: BC integrated operation. It can be envisioned that deep distribution focuses on terminals, so it engages in terminal interception; digital marketing focuses on the user side, so it first engages in user interception to get users online, then implements BC integrated operation.
